Home Sleep Test

This test diagnoses sleep apnea using a device called a "Watch-PAT" worn on the wrist at bedtime. A finger probe accurately measures your peripheral arterial tone (PAT) or breathing events during sleep. Blood oxygen levels, pulse rate, movement, and snoring are also recorded.
